Output f899867690da148bce5a05cf9af2586504ca0bc3dd11c0f3e13bb1c767f39d56:61

value
2183817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2575096e6c1c4fda5e6658a2bcedd87a54c7bcd4 OP_EQUAL
address
35758WAv7p6P6DhfztjyGdjKx6NmevJGBG
transaction
f899867690da148bce5a05cf9af2586504ca0bc3dd11c0f3e13bb1c767f39d56
confirmations
244714
spent
true